REASONS FOR JUDGMENT
On 27 May 2009 a Notice of Appeal was filed in this Court by the appellant who has been identified by the pseudonym ‘SZNID’.
On 22 June 2009 a letter was apparently sent by the Court to the appellant at the address given at the foot of his Notice of Appeal filed 27 May 2009, which was the same address as that included in a Notice of Change of Address forwarded to the Department of Immigration and Citizenship which reached the Department on 15 January 2009. The letter from the Court to the appellant notified him of the fact that his appeal would be heard today at 10:15am.
On 25 June 2009 the solicitor for the respondent Minister forwarded a copy of the Appeal Book to the appellant at the same address; again notifying him that the matter had been listed for hearing before the Court at 10:15am today and that the hearing would take place in the courtroom in which I am presently sitting.
A further letter was sent to the appellant on 18 August 2009 enclosing a copy of the respondent Minister’s submissions, once again reminding him of the fact that the hearing of his matter would take place before the Court in this courtroom at 10:15am today.
The name of the appellant and the pseudonym by which he is known have each been called outside the court three times and he has failed to appear. It is now 10:36am.
In the circumstances the solicitor for the first respondent has asked the Court to dismiss the appeal in accordance with s 25(2B)(bb)(ii) of the Federal Court of Australia Act 1976 (Cth) and it seems to be appropriate that I should do so.
